I recently installed Lion on a 32G flash drive, preferring to stay in the shallow end of the pool for now.
However, even though I selected Automatic Login for the primary user (me), the iMac goes to the login screen whenever it goes to sleep.
I've checked and rechecked System Prefs > Users and Groups > Login Options > Automatic login, and cycled it on and off.
Still, I get the login window and need my password.
What am I missing?
